Find the sum. 12x2 + 9x2 =

OpenStudy (johnweldon1993):

Ahh, different than multiplication! This time...DONT TOUCH THE EXPONENTS! lol Just add the coefficients 12x² + 9x² so you add 12 + 9 and bring down the x and the ² and you get?

OpenStudy (anonymous):

21x2....you like my math don't you lol
